| #ifndef _itt_shared_malloc_MapMemory_H |
| #define _itt_shared_malloc_MapMemory_H |
| |
| #if __linux__ || __APPLE__ || __sun || __FreeBSD__ |
| |
| #if __sun && !defined(_XPG4_2) |
| // To have void* as mmap's 1st argument |
| #define _XPG4_2 1 |
| #define XPG4_WAS_DEFINED 1 |
| #endif |
| |
| #include <sys/mman.h> |
| |
| #if XPG4_WAS_DEFINED |
| #undef _XPG4_2 |
| #undef XPG4_WAS_DEFINED |
| #endif |
| |
| #define MEMORY_MAPPING_USES_MALLOC 0 |
| void* MapMemory (size_t bytes) |
| { |
| void* result = 0; |
| #ifndef MAP_ANONYMOUS |
| // Mac OS* X defines MAP_ANON, which is deprecated in Linux. |
| #define MAP_ANONYMOUS MAP_ANON |
| #endif /* MAP_ANONYMOUS */ |
| result = mmap(result, bytes, (PROT_READ | PROT_WRITE), MAP_PRIVATE|MAP_ANONYMOUS, -1, 0); |
| return result==MAP_FAILED? 0: result; |
| } |
| |
| int UnmapMemory(void *area, size_t bytes) |
| { |
| return munmap(area, bytes); |
| } |
| |
| #elif _WIN32 || _WIN64 |
| #include <windows.h> |
| |
| #define MEMORY_MAPPING_USES_MALLOC 0 |
| void* MapMemory (size_t bytes) |
| { |
| /* Is VirtualAlloc thread safe? */ |
| return VirtualAlloc(NULL, bytes, (MEM_RESERVE | MEM_COMMIT | MEM_TOP_DOWN), PAGE_READWRITE); |
| } |
| |
| int UnmapMemory(void *area, size_t bytes) |
| { |
| BOOL result = VirtualFree(area, 0, MEM_RELEASE); |
| return !result; |
| } |
| |
| #else |
| #include <stdlib.h> |
| |
| #define MEMORY_MAPPING_USES_MALLOC 1 |
| void* MapMemory (size_t bytes) |
| { |
| return malloc( bytes ); |
| } |
| |
| int UnmapMemory(void *area, size_t bytes) |
| { |
| free( area ); |
| return 0; |
| } |
| |
| #endif /* OS dependent */ |
| |
| #if MALLOC_CHECK_RECURSION && MEMORY_MAPPING_USES_MALLOC |
| #error Impossible to protect against malloc recursion when memory mapping uses malloc. |
| #endif |
| |
| #endif /* _itt_shared_malloc_MapMemory_H */ |
